Why You Can’t Activate the Checkout Extension Block?

Modified on Mon, 15 Dec at 8:44 PM

If you’re unable to activate or add a Checkout Extension Block, this is due to a current limitation set by Shopify.

At the moment, adding app blocks directly to the checkout page is only available for stores on the Shopify Plus plan. Shopify restricts checkout customization for non-Plus plans, which means merchants on other plans cannot install or manage Checkout Extension Blocks from the checkout editor.


What This Means for Non-Shopify Plus Stores

If your store is not on Shopify Plus, there’s no need to worry—this limitation does not prevent the app from working.


You do not need to add the block manually from the checkout page. Instead, you can simply:

  • Open the app

  • Configure the rules and settings you want

  • Save your changes


Once set up, the app will automatically apply those rules during checkout, even without the Checkout Extension Block being added in the checkout editor.


Summary

  • Checkout Extension Blocks can only be added on Shopify Plus stores

  • This is a Shopify platform limitation, not an app issue

  • Non-Plus merchants can still use the app by configuring rules directly within the app

  • The app will function on the checkout page based on those rules
